大家好,今天我们要聊的是如何开发一个宿舍信息管理系统,并且怎么申请软著证书。这个系统可以帮助宿舍管理员更好地管理宿舍信息,提高工作效率。我们先从代码开始吧。
一、系统开发
首先,我们需要选择一种编程语言。这里我推荐使用Python,因为它简单易学,而且有很多强大的库支持。接下来是数据库设计。我们可以使用SQLite作为我们的数据库,因为它轻量级且易于部署。
1. 安装依赖
pip install flask sqlite3
2. 创建数据库
import sqlite3
conn = sqlite3.connect('dormitory.db')
cursor = conn.cursor()
cursor.execute('''CREATE TABLE dorms (
id INTEGER PRIMARY KEY,
name TEXT NOT NULL,
capacity INTEGER NOT NULL,
available_beds INTEGER NOT NULL
);''')
conn.commit()
conn.close()
3. 编写Web接口
from flask import Flask, request
app = Flask(__name__)
@app.route('/dorms', methods=['GET'])
def get_dorms():
conn = sqlite3.connect('dormitory.db')
cursor = conn.cursor()
cursor.execute("SELECT * FROM dorms")
rows = cursor.fetchall()
conn.close()
return {'dorms': rows}
if __name__ == '__main__':
app.run(debug=True)
二、软著证书申请
完成了系统的开发后,别忘了申请软著证书。软著证书是软件著作权的证明,可以保护你的知识产权。申请流程大致分为提交材料、等待审核和领取证书三个步骤。
你需要准备的材料包括软件的源代码、软件用户手册等。提交给中国版权保护中心后,耐心等待审核结果即可。
好了,今天的分享就到这里。希望这些信息对你有所帮助!如果你有任何问题或建议,欢迎留言讨论。